Purpose and scope of the recommendation

Within a programme, the information linked to problems with the products, processes and associated resources, which occur throughout the lifecycle of these products (confirmed problems) must be methodically analysed with a view to eradicating the causes of these incidents and treat their effects.

The guiding principle is to define a system for collection and processing of these data, within the framework of the customer/supplier relations, at whatever level.

This recommendation is designed to constitute a basis, within a given programme, for defining, setting up and implementing a failure reporting analysis and corrective actions system (FRACAS).

This document is therefore intended for supplier programme or project managers, more particularly for those responsible for defining and implementing this logic within their management teams (quality assurance, dependability and safety, etc.).

This recommendation can also constitute a basis for choosing the extent to which this FRACAS is to be formalised, depending on the specificity of the programme.

This recommendation is usable for any programme involving various actors at various levels, in particular in the case of large programmes (aerospace, weapons, etc). It can also be used to manage programmes launched with no outside contract.

The FRACAS applies to any incident occurring during a programme or during the lifecycle of a product developed and built under this programme and in particular during:

— the design of the product;

— construction;

— procurements necessary for manufacturing;

— testing;

— delivery;

— storage;

— operation;

— maintenance;

— product retirement from service and disposal.

It also concerns the components of these products and the associated means and processes implemented.

It is up to the programme managers to decide on what is to be adopted or adapted in order to optimise attainment of their targets.

The FRACAS requirements adopted for a given programme must be described in the management plan produced in response to the programme management specification.
